tabarani:12318ʿAbdān b. Aḥmad > ʿUmar b. al-ʿAbbās al-Rāzī > ʿAbd al-Raḥman b. Mahdī > Yaʿqūb al-Qummī > Jaʿfar b. Abū al-Mughīrah > Saʿīd b. Jubayr > Ibn ʿAbbās

[Machine] When the Prophet ﷺ conquered Mecca, Iblis trembled with fear. His soldiers gathered around him and he said, "We have lost hope of getting the nation of Muhammad to commit shirk (associating partners with Allah) after today. But let us tempt them in their religion and spread among them hypocrisy."  

الطبراني:١٢٣١٨حَدَّثَنَا عَبْدَانُ بْنُ أَحْمَدَ ثنا عُمَرُ بْنُ الْعَبَّاسِ الرَّازِيُّ ثنا عَبْدُ الرَّحْمَنِ بْنُ مَهْدِيٍّ ثنا يَعْقُوبُ الْقُمِّيُّ عَنْ جَعْفَرِ بْنِ أَبِي الْمُغِيرَةِ عَنْ سَعِيدِ بْنِ جُبَيْرٍ عَنِ ابْنِ عَبَّاسٍ ؓ قَالَ

لَمَّا افْتَتَحَ النَّبِيُّ ﷺ مَكَّةَ رَنَّ إِبْلِيسُ رَنَّةً اجْتَمَعَتْ إِلَيْهِ جُنُودُهُ فَقَالَ ايْئَسُوا أَنْ نُرِيدَ أُمَّةَ مُحَمَّدٍ عَلَى الشِّرْكِ بَعْدَ يَوْمِكُمْ هَذَا وَلَكِنِ افْتُنُوهُمْ فِي دِينِهِمْ وَأَفْشُوا فِيهِمُ النَّوْحَ
